Table 1.
Mean cumulative per-participant costs (in €) by condition over a 6-month follow-up period (based on intention-to-treat sample; N=128).
Costs | Intervention group (n=64), mean (95% CI) | Control group, (n=64), mean (95% CI) | Incremental costs, difference (95% CI) | |
Direct medical costs | ||||
|
Intervention costs | 299a | —b | 299a |
|
General practitioner | 36 (21 to 51) | 51 (36 to 66) | –15 (–36 to 6) |
|
Mental health care | 150 (56 to 244) | 163 (69 to 257) | –13 (–146 to 120) |
|
Antidepressants | 2 (0 to 5) | 5 (2 to 8) | –3 (–7 to 1) |
|
Allied health servicesc | 105 (34 to 176) | 170 (99 to 241) | –65 (–166 to 36) |
Patient and family costs | ||||
|
Informal care | 884 (226 to 1541) | 1260 (602 to 1918) | –376 (–1306 to 554) |
|
Domestic help | 310 (147 to 474) | (132 to 459) | 15 (–217 to 246) |
|
Out-of-pocket expensesd | 45(7 to 84) | 73 (35 to 112) | –28 (-82 to 27) a |
|
Travel | 8 (3 to 13) | 15 (10 to 20) | –7 (–14 to 1) |
Productivity costs | ||||
|
Absenteeism | 1005 (473 to 1537) | 1104 (573 to 1636) | –99 (–851 to 653) |
|
Presenteeism | 1185 (747 to 1623) | 1883 (1446 to 2321) | –698 |
Total costs | 4030 (2951 to 5108) | 5021 (3942 to 6099) | –991 (–2519 to 534) |
aAs intervention costs are fixed, no 95% CI is applicable here.
bNot applicable.
cIncluding physiotherapist, massage, occupational therapist, etc.
dFor example, allied health services without prescription.
